How do you title a works cited page?

The Works Cited page is the list of sources used in the research paper. It should be its own page at the end of the paper. Center the title, “Works Cited” (without quotation marks), at the top of the page. If only one source was consulted, title the page “Work Cited”.

What should go in the title line on your Works Cited page?

Title: On the first line, the title of the page—“Works Cited”—should appear centered, and not italicized or bolded. Spacing: Like the rest of your paper, this page should be double-spaced and have 1-inch margins (don’t skip an extra line after the title or between citations!).

What is MLA citation format?

MLA citing format often includes the following pieces of information, in this order: Author’s Last name, First name. “Title of Source.” Title of Container, other contributors, version, numbers, publisher, publication date, location.

How do you write the title of a book in MLA format?

Titles of books, plays, films, periodicals, databases, and websites are italicized. Place titles in quotation marks if the source is part of a larger work. Articles, essays, chapters, poems, webpages, songs, and speeches are placed in quotation marks. Sometimes titles will contain other titles.

Which citation is formatted correctly using MLA?

MLA format follows the author-page method of in-text citation. This means that the author’s last name and the page number(s) from which the quotation or paraphrase is taken must appear in the text, and a complete reference should appear on your Works Cited page.
